Step 1: Understanding Job Loss
- Recognize the Reality: Accept that job loss can happen to anyone and often comes unexpectedly.
- Reflect on the Experience: Take time to understand the reasons behind your job loss. This could include company downsizing, personal performance, or industry shifts.
- Seek Support: Connect with friends, family, or career coaches who can provide emotional and professional support during this transition.
Step 2: Exploring Business Opportunities
- Identify Your Skills: List the skills and experiences you possess that could be valuable in a business context.
- Market Research: Research potential business ideas that align with your skills and market needs. Look for gaps in the market or emerging trends.
- Consider Starting Small: Think about starting a side business or freelance work to test your business idea before fully committing.
Step 3: Developing a Business Model
- Utilize the Business Model Canvas: This strategic management tool helps outline your business idea on a single page. Key components include:
- Value Proposition
- Customer Segments
- Revenue Streams
- Key Activities
- Key Partners
- Cost Structure
- Iterate on Your Model: Be prepared to adjust your business model based on feedback and market changes.
Step 4: Building a Support Network
- Engage with Family and Friends: Consider involving family members in your business venture to strengthen bonds and share responsibilities.
- Network with Other Entrepreneurs: Join local business groups or online communities to share experiences, gain insights, and find mentorship.
Step 5: Embracing Transparency in Business
- Communicate Openly: Establish transparent communication practices with employees and stakeholders to build trust.
- Set Clear Expectations: Make sure everyone involved understands their roles and the business goals.
Step 6: Navigating Career Transitions
- Stay Informed: Keep up with trends in your industry, including the impact of technology like AI on job roles and business operations.
- Be Open to Change: Explore opportunities for upskilling or reskilling to remain competitive in the job market or to enhance your business.
